There is no State-wise budgetary allocation of the funds under NLCPR scheme of Ministry of Development of North Eastern Region. Funds under NLCPR-Central component of the scheme are released to the respective central implementing agencies. However, under NLCPR-State component of the scheme, project-wise funds are released to the respective State Governments for implementation. The state-wise details of funds released under NLCPR-State component during the last five years are as under:

As per the extant guidelines, all non-exempted Central Ministries/Departments, are mandated to spend atleast 10% of Gross Budgetary Support (GBS) for Central Sector and Centrally Sponsored Schemes in North Eastern Region (NER). However, instead of a pre-decided State-wise allocation, funds are spent by the concerned Ministries/Departments in the North Eastern States, against sanctioned projects/schemes.
This information was given by Minister for Development of North Eastern Region Shri G. Kishan Reddy in the Rajya Sabha in a written reply today.
